COUNCIL BLUFFS, Iowa (WOWT) -- Kenny Petty's dog Shady is still recovering after being shot in the jaw. A portion of her face was shattered, and her veterinarian said she was nearly killed.

Petty told WOWT 6 News that Council Bluffs police shot his dog while he was being served with a search warrant. Her face was mangled after being shot.

"The vet told me she is one tough nail and he don't know how she's here," Petty said, fighting back tears.

The incident unfolded last week when, Petty said, police came into his home. Petty said it’s no secret he has a long criminal history, but he believes his dog paid the price.
